MACT orders Rs 45.78 lakh relief

Chandigarh: The Motor Accident Claims Tribunal (MACT) has announced a compensation of Rs 45.78 lakh to a family residing in Sector 49 in an accident death case.

The tribunal has directed the owner of a tipper, driver and National Insurance Company Ltd, Sector 26, to jointly and severally pay the compensation along with an interest of 7.5 per cent per annum from the date of application and realisation. Advocate Sunil K Dixit said the tribunal had announced the compensation to the deceased’s wife and three children. According to the plea, on May 5, 2016, Nageshwar Parsad was riding a motorcycle near Radha Swami Chowk, Sector 71, when the tipper, coming from the Industrial Area, jumped the red light and hit the motorcycle. The motorcyclist died in the accident. TNS

Man jumps before train, dies

Dera Bassi: An unidentified man reportedly committed suicide by jumping in front of a train here on Tuesday night. According to GRP sources, they got information that a man had committed suicide. The police reached the spot and took the body into custody. The deceased appeared to be a slum resident and is believed to be about 30 years old. The police tried to get the victim identified, but did not succeed. OC 

Two theft cases reported

Chandigarh: Two cases of theft have been reported from the city. While Rs 40,000 was stolen from a cargo vehicle after breaking a windowpane, Rs 4,000 and a laptop were stolen from an office in the Industrial Area. Shadab Mustafa Qadari, a resident of Phase I, Ram Darbar, reported that someone stole Rs 40,000 and documents after breaking the windowpane of his cargo vehicle that was parked in a market at Burail village on May 14. In another incident, Shishpal Garg complained that Rs 4,000 and a laptop were stolen from his office in the Industrial Area, Phase II. TNS

3 computers stolen from office

Chandigarh: The police have registered a theft case after three computers were reportedly stolen from Central Revenue Building, Sector 17. According to the police, Dharambir, superintendent, Central Excise and Service Tax Commissioner's Office, Chandigarh, reported that someone stole three computers from the building between May 2 and May 4. The police have registered a case. TNS 

Biker crushed to death

Mohali: A motorbike-borne youth was killed after being run over by a tractor-trailer at the Siswan T-point in Mullanpur on Wednesday. The victim has been identified as Mohit Kumar, a resident of Ballangarh village. The police said the victim stopped on the roadside to drink water when the rashly-driven trailer crushed him and sped away. The police have registered a case. TNS
